Output 2598849b86030eae0f05ccf99e5423664b96d0aa4609e9e403f5c0d2be934057:1

value
98871621
script pubkey
OP_0 OP_PUSHBYTES_20 3cddba26e7993d884b6fb42e5075cced01063bc1
address
bc1q8nwm5fh8ny7csjm0ksh9qawva5qsvw7pqfpyzw
transaction
2598849b86030eae0f05ccf99e5423664b96d0aa4609e9e403f5c0d2be934057
spent
true